How It Works

  • 1Compression: Reciprocating compressor raises refrigerant pressure and temperature.
  • 2Heat Rejection: Cooling water in the condenser removes heat & condenses refrigerant.
  • 3Expansion: Expansion device drops refrigerant pressure and temperature.
  • 4Heat Absorption: Evaporator chills process water; cooled water is circulated to load.

Water-Cooled vs Air-Cooled

FeatureWater-CooledAir-Cooled
Cooling TowerRequiredNot Required
Water ConsumptionHigherNone
Energy EfficiencyHigherGood
Running CostLowerHigher
Initial CostHigherLower
Tropical PerformanceExcellentGood
Large Industrial LoadsIdealSuitable

Choose water-cooled when: long operating hours, energy efficiency priority, cooling tower available, and large industrial loads.

What is a water-cooled reciprocating chiller?

A water-cooled reciprocating chiller is an industrial refrigeration system that uses a reciprocating compressor and water-cooled condenser to produce chilled water for manufacturing, process cooling, and HVAC applications.

How does a water-cooled reciprocating chiller work?

The system compresses refrigerant, rejects heat through a water-cooled condenser, reduces pressure through an expansion device, and absorbs heat through the evaporator to produce chilled water.

What is the advantage of a water-cooled chiller?

Water-cooled chillers typically offer higher energy efficiency, lower operating costs, and more stable performance than air-cooled systems, particularly in large industrial applications.

Does a water-cooled reciprocating chiller require a cooling tower?

Yes. Water-cooled chillers typically use cooling towers to reject heat from the condenser and maintain efficient operation.

What maintenance is required?

Routine maintenance includes condenser cleaning, cooling tower maintenance, refrigerant checks, compressor inspections, water treatment monitoring, and electrical system inspections.
